- [ ] **Step 7: Breaker override escrow.** After sealing the signing keys for the Tallgrove upstream API circuit breaker, confirm the support team can force the breaker open during a full outage. The override bundle lives in the sealed escrow drawer and is useless without its unlock phrase. Two ceremony witnesses must initial this step before proceeding. The escrow bundle is decrypted with the recovery passphrase that follows.

vault phrase of kahip-kahop = holath-quenmir

Before rotating the signing keys for the Copperline internal API gateway, confirm the rate-limiting config is frozen. New keys invalidate cached limiter tokens, so any mid-ceremony config change can cause a thundering retry storm against downstream services. Verify the freeze flag in the Larkspan dashboard, have a second team member countersign the checklist, and record the ceremony timestamp. Then unlock the key custodian account by entering the recovery passphrase that appears below:

unlock words, hahip-baduf: holwyn-istath-julvan

### Bloom filter says "maybe," store says "nope"

If Kestrel KV shows high miss rates despite bloom filter passes, the filter's probably stale — it rebuilds hourly from the Ferncache snapshot. Quick fix: trigger a manual rebuild via the admin endpoint. That endpoint requires auth, so include the token below in your request.

portal login ticket: eyJhbGciOiJIUzI1NiIsInR5cCI6IkpXVCJ9.eyJzdWIiOiIHooecZRxdGIn0.Bzf73fI4k6sq